What is PA MV-426B

The Pennsylvania MV-426B Reconstructed Vehicle Application is a government form used by vehicle owners in Pennsylvania to apply for titles for reconstructed, specially constructed, collectible, modified, or flood/recovered theft vehicles.

Eligibility to use the Pennsylvania MV-426B form includes individuals who own a reconstructed, specially constructed, collectible, modified, or flood/recovered theft vehicle seeking a title.
Required documents typically include identification, current title if available, inspection reports, and any additional supporting materials that verify vehicle modifications.
The completed MV-426B form can be submitted in person at your local DMV office or via mail to the Pennsylvania DMV, depending on their current submission guidelines.
Common mistakes include leaving required fields blank, providing inaccurate vehicle information, and failing to include necessary signatures from inspectors or reviewers.
There are no specific deadlines for submitting the MV-426B form, but it is advisable to complete it as soon as possible to avoid delays in obtaining the vehicle title.
Processing times can vary, but typically you can expect to hear back from the DMV within several weeks after submission, depending on their workload.
Yes, there may be fees associated with filing the MV-426B application, including title fees and any additional inspection costs. Check with the Pennsylvania DMV for the most accurate fee schedule.
